Festive baking session gets Jack Dormand into the Christmas spiritResidents at HC-One’s Jack Dormand Care Home in Peterlee, County Durham, gathered in the dining room for some festive baking.

Christmas music was put on in the background whilst Residents chose which festive cutter they would like to use to cut out the biscuit mix with. 

Whilst they waited for the biscuits to cook there was a Christmas themed quiz and everyone told their favourite festive joke. As soon as the biscuits were cooked and cooled down enough to decorate, the Residents decorated them with lots of lovely colours.

As always, the best bit was being able to taste their creations!
